Philips Healthcare Inc. recalls Philips DigitalDiagnost X-Ray System with Eleva Software 2.1.3 Model numbers 712020, 712022, and 712082 Product Us
Recalled March 6, 2013 · FDA recall Z-0884-2013 · Philips Healthcare
Hazard
When the operator for a wall stand view selects an "image rotation" different from default, or such image rotation is preset in the examination database, then the resulting image may be rotated in the wrong direction. When the operator manually rotates the image back, electronic side markers (if programmed) are rotated also and as a result may be placed in a wrong position inside the image. · FDA Class II
Units
551
Sold at
Worldwide Distribution - USA Nationwide and the Foreign countries of: Austria, Canada, Belgium, China,Denmark, France, germany, Italy, Netherlands,New Zealand, Norway, Philippines, Portugual, SOuth Korea, Spain, Switzerland, Thailand, and UK.
